What Is IPTV?

IPTV involves the delivery of television content over the internet instead of traditional satellite or cable systems. With IPTV, users can view a vast selection of channels from around the world through an internet connection. It grants flexibility in content selection, with options for live streaming, video-on-demand (VOD), and including time-shifted TV. The convenience and affordability of IPTV have made it widely adopted among tech-savvy consumers who prefer more control over their viewing experience.

What is IPTV?
I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) delivers television content through the internet rather than traditional cable systems. It enables users to watch real-time channels, on-demand shows, or recorded programs using any internet-connected device.
Is IPTV legal?
IPTV is perfectly legal when using authorized providers. However, some platforms advertising “unpaid” content may violate copyright laws. Always opt for trusted services with clear pricing and proper licensing.
